Tôi muốn thêm một tính năng tương tự vào công cụ mà tôi đang tạo. Tôi quan tâm đến cách nó hoạt động mã khôn ngoan. Tôi muốn có thể nhận được một trang html và loại trừ tất cả trừ bài báo.Tính năng đọc của Safari hoạt động như thế nào?
Trả lời
Dự án khả năng đọc có chức năng tương tự với Chrome và iOS. Tôi không chắc làm thế nào nó phát hiện các nội dung tự động nhưng tôi biết rằng khả năng đọc có một API cho những người muốn tích hợp các tính năng của nó. Bạn có thể muốn kiểm tra điều đó.
Tôi nghĩ rằng bạn đang tìm kiếm một Reader RSS. Url cho trang web thực sự đang cung cấp cho bạn tệp XML là bản tóm tắt nội dung trên trang. Khá đơn giản để thực hiện. Nếu bạn có thêm thông tin về những gì bạn đang phát triển (ngôn ngữ, loại nội dung) có thể dễ dàng hơn để chỉ cho bạn một ví dụ. Người đọc không phải là tước trang đi mặc dù, nó là nhận được một bản tóm tắt. Để tách một trang có thể được thực hiện tùy thuộc vào những gì bạn đang cố gắng làm.
Xin chào Joe, Tôi đang cố gắng thực hiện để khi bạn nhấp vào nút "xem" trên trang web sau: Daisy.camorada.com Chế độ bật lên xuất hiện giống như nút trình đọc của safari. Bất kỳ ý tưởng về cách tôi có thể làm điều này? Tôi nghĩ rằng nút đọc của safari không chỉ là tóm tắt. –
Nếu bạn đang làm việc với Ruby, bạn có thể sử dụng Pismo. Nó trích xuất một bài báo từ một tài liệu nhất định.
- 1. Tính năng RescueTimes chặn hoạt động như thế nào?
- 2. Tính năng ghi đè url hoạt động như thế nào?
- 3. Tính năng Định tuyến Web hoạt động như thế nào?
- 4. memory_limit: Tính năng này hoạt động như thế nào?
- 5. Tính năng kế thừa ảo hoạt động như thế nào?
- 6. Tính năng khóa phạm vi hoạt động như thế nào?
- 7. Tính năng getAltitude() của Vị trí GPS Android hoạt động như thế nào
- 8. Chức năng cmp_to_key của Python hoạt động như thế nào?
- 9. Tính năng định vị của trình duyệt web hoạt động như thế nào?
- 10. Tính năng tích hợp liên tục của bạn hoạt động như thế nào?
- 11. Tính năng phục hồi trạng thái UIWebView của iOS 6 hoạt động như thế nào?
- 12. JPA: Khóa đọc hoạt động như thế nào?
- 13. Tính năng hiểu lambda/năng suất/máy phát điện này hoạt động như thế nào?
- 14. Chức năng giảm hoạt động như thế nào?
- 15. Chức năng này hoạt động như thế nào?
- 16. Định nghĩa chức năng sau hoạt động như thế nào?
- 17. Điều phối viên - Tính năng này hoạt động như thế nào?
- 18. Các lớp thuộc tính hoạt động như thế nào?
- 19. Chức năng jQuery pushStack hoạt động như thế nào?
- 20. Mã chức năng python này hoạt động như thế nào?
- 21. như thế nào "chậm trễ" chức năng này hoạt động
- 22. Chức năng C cụ thể hoạt động như thế nào?
- 23. Khả năng hiển thị ngược không hoạt động đúng trong Firefox (Hoạt động trong Safari)
- 24. Chức năng scanf hoạt động như thế nào trong C?
- 25. ArrayAccess hoạt động như thế nào?
- 26. Tính năng nhận dạng cử chỉ hoạt động như thế nào?
- 27. Tính năng nào của Zepto không hoạt động trên ie9?
- 28. Tính năng bản địa hóa gia tăng hoạt động như thế nào?
- 29. Tính năng phủ định hợp lý hoạt động như thế nào trong C?
- 30. Tính năng tạm ngưng giao dịch hoạt động như thế nào trong MySQL?
Cảm ơn. Cái nhìn này giống với những gì tôi đang tìm kiếm. –
Thực ra tôi nghĩ trình đọc Safari dựa trên Khả năng đọc. – Hassan